About the Ensemble
The University of St. Thomas Concert Choir is a select, mixed ensemble of 60 – 80 students representing a number of major fields. Choir members sing a varied repertoire, including secular and sacred music from all historical eras. Every spring the Concert Choir and Chamber Singers perform a major chora/orchestral work with professional orchestra. Recent pieces include Mozart’s Mass in C minor, Brahms’ Ein Deutsches Requiem, Handel’s Messiah, and Haydn’s Missa in Illo Tempore and this year’s Requiem by Giuseppe Verdi. The choir tours locally, regionally, and internationally, having traveled to Italy in 2006, Central Europe in 2003, and Spain in 2000. The choir was selected to sing at the Minnesota Music Educators Association annual convention in 2007 and 2001, and the American Choral Director’s Association of Minnesota annual convention in 2004.
